Summary

A multicenter, prospective, single-arm clinical investigation to evaluate the short term and long term safety of a modified staged treatment algorithm using the AeriSeal System.

Detailed description

The AeriSeal-STAGE trial will be a prospective, multicenter study that intends to evaluate the safety of a modified staged treatment algorithm with an escalation of dose using the AeriSeal System in the treatment of subjects with severe emphysema in a controlled trial design setting as compared to published data from prior studies. The trial is anticipated to enroll fifteen (15) study subjects with homogeneous, or upper lobe predominant heterogeneous emphysema, in three (3) centers in Europe.

DEVICEAeriSeal SystemSubjects will undergo two bronchoscopy procedures two months apart and will be treated with AeriSeal foam unilaterally, in two sub-segments during each bronchoscopy (4 segments treated in total).
